I will also be in the spine forum. My impression is that you have multipal issues going on. I am curious as to how old your MRI is?. The neruo symptoms do have me concerned as well, because you have nerve impingement. Those pins and needles, etc, do happen with PN:, but because of what your symptoms are, I would venture that it is due to your back. It would serve you well, if you could find another couple of doctors to talk to you about this. Loss of strength is showing there is a problem. Do you have a neurologist surgeon? Not all of them want to do surgery. They will be able to tell you if it is the nerves that is causing the PN like symptoms. Either way, doesn't feel very good. You don't want your spine to deteriorate, so evaluations really are the way to go. The more information you get from the doctors, the better off you will be when making a decision on what to do about it. It is your choice, so don't be talked into anything you don't want. Look up all tests that your doctor may want to do other than the MRI. Some of them just confirm that you have an issue, and just cause pain. I declined some of those painful tests. You did give enough information without the actual pictures. When nerves are compressed, this does indeed cause the symptoms you are feeling. Before consenting to my last fusion, I had multipal opinions that said it was absolutely necessary, All doctors gave same impression. I do wish you all the best.
